Ingredients:
For the Filling:
3 cups cooked, shredded chicken (rotisserie chicken works great)
8 oz (1 block) cream cheese, softened
1 cup sour cream
1 can (4 oz) diced green chilies
1/2 cup shredded cheddar or Monterey Jack cheese
1 tsp garlic powder
1 tsp cumin
1/2 tsp chili powder
Salt and pepper to taste
For the Enchiladas:
10-12 medium-sized flour or corn tortillas
1 can (10 oz) enchilada sauce (red or green, depending on preference)
1 cup shredded cheese (cheddar, Monterey Jack, or a Mexican blend)
Fresh cilantro or green onions for garnish (optional)
